Description | The ADR4520/ADR4525/ADR4530/ADR4533/ADR4540/ADR4550 devices are high precision, low power, low noise voltage references featuring ±0.02% B, C, and D grade maximum initial error, excellent temperature... |
Features |
PIN CONFIGURATIONS
► Maximum temperature coefficient (TCVOUT): ► 0.8 ppm/°C (D grade 0°C to 70°C) ► 1 ppm/°C (C grade 0°C to 70°C) ► 2 ppm/°C (B grade −40°C to +125°C) ► 4 ppm/°C (A grade −40°C to +125°C) ► Output noise (0.1 Hz to 10 Hz): ► 1 μV p-p at VOUT of 2.048 V typical ► Initial output voltage error: ► B, C, D grade: ±0.02% (maximum) ► Input voltage range: 3 V to 15 V ► Operating temperature: ► A grade and B grade: −40°C to +125°C ► C grade and D grade: 0°C to +70°C ► Output current: +10 mA source/−10 mA sink ► Low quiescent current: 950 μA (maximum) ► Low dropout voltage: 300 mV at 2... |
